High legal fees and drawn out court cases are a thing of the past with net-ARB’s online arbitration service. Bringing together parties irrespective of geographic concerns with experts in alternative dispute resolution, net-ARB is the best solution when conflicts arise.

1.Affordable: net-ARB's total cost is less than the filing fees of many courts. At $199 internet arbitration is the most affordable dispute resolution service available.

2.Availability: Geographic restrictions prohibit justice in many ways today. Suppliers, providers and users worldwide find email the only solution to settle disagreements.

3.Fast: Small claims court can take months to start. Online arbitration hearings begin immediately and awards are typically rendered within 48 hours of the hearing ending.

4.Private: In most cases, court decisions and personal information pertaining to the participants become public record. Online arbitration is contractually confidential.

5.Productive: Paying lawyers by the hour inherently creates a conflict of interest. net-ARB’s flat fee and ease of email allows anybody to get justice anywhere.

6.Equality: Legal justice is prohibitively expensive. Now it’s available to those who can’t afford lawyers, are geographically isolated, or just want a better solution.

7.Endorsed: The Conflict Resolution Academy, a leading international resource for conflict management and leadership training, reviews and endorses all net-ARB arbitrators.
